Output 306ce5d969f26ffa11328eb99402c5809e45bd330ec24143c0a3605ad9ed6b63:1

value
81957725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ba3586ec5385c2d1e80fe6b696535aef588aae92 OP_EQUAL
address
3JfbjMAGPYbAf2aW3F2sFUaxmcNh4z27Bk
transaction
306ce5d969f26ffa11328eb99402c5809e45bd330ec24143c0a3605ad9ed6b63
spent
true